Mohamed Salah returns to the Liverpool line-up for Wednesday’s Champions League clash with Genk in Belgium after missing the weekend draw with Manchester United due to injury. The Egyptian sat out the Premier League match at Old Trafford, which finished 1-1, because of an ankle problem. Arsenal manager Unai Emery asked for fans to give him time as doubts grow over the Spaniard’s ability to lead the Gunners back into the Champions League. A disappointing 1-0 defeat at promoted Sheffield United on Monday left Arsenal fifth in the Premier League, after just four wins in their opening nine games. The Federal Executive Council has approved the change of name for Ministry of Communications. At the meeting on Wednesday, FEC says the ministry is now to be called Ministry of Communications and Digital Economy. A four-year-old child was killed during the latest round of protests in Chile, raising the death toll from five days of social unrest to 18, a top Chilean security official said Wednesday.
